Cuisinart belgian waffle maker recipe

nonstick cooking spray
4 cups unbleached, all-purpose flour
cup granulated sugar
two tablespoons baking powder
1 teaspoon table salt
3 cups lowfat buttermilk
1 teaspoon pure vanilla flavoring
cup unsalted butter, melted and cooled
4 large eggs, gently beaten

Gently coat a Cuisinart Belgian Waffle Maker with nonstick cooking spray. Preheat to preferred setting.
Inside a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
Combine the buttermilk, vanilla, butter and eggs within the Cuisinart mixing bowl. While using Chef’s Whisk, mix on speed 2 for around thirty seconds, after which finish on speed 3 for the next thirty seconds, or until completely homogeneous. Using the motor running on speed 1, gradually add some dry ingredients mix until just combined.

Pour two glasses of batter to the prepared, preheated waffle maker. Rapidly and thoroughly spread the batter evenly. Close the coverage and prepare until tone sounds.
Serve immediately.

Servings: Makes 20 waffles

Dietary information per serving

Calories 160 (31% from fat) • carb. 23g • pro. 4g • fat 5g • sitting. fat 4g • chol. 25mg • sod. 280mg • calc. 135mg • fiber 0g
